Break-glass access: profile-store resharding (Kettlevane). Use only if the shard migrator wedges mid-cutover and on-call is unreachable. Steps: freeze writes via the Ledgekeeper toggle, snapshot both shard maps, then open the emergency admin shell on the coordinator node. Release manager must log the incident before proceeding. The emergency shell prompts once for credentials; respond with the passphrase below.

vault phrase of faduf-hagug = frair-eliath-briion-quenix-kasael

// REINDEX_BATCH_CAP limits docs per shard pass in the Tallowfield
// nightly search reindex. Raising it starves the ingest queue;
// lowering it overruns the maintenance window. 5000 is the tested
// sweet spot. Change only with a soak run. Verified against the
// build noted below.

session token of bawif-hahog = htk6_ac5981

Subject: DR drill results — ParityScope checker

Team,

We completed the quarterly disaster-recovery drill for ParityScope, our hotel rate-parity checker, on schedule. Failover to the Brindlemoor standby region took 14 minutes; scrape queues resumed cleanly. One gap: the restore of the comparison cache required manual unsealing by the on-call. For audit completeness, the passphrase used to unseal the archive is recorded below.

vault phrase of hagug-fawif = istmir-novvan-ulaeth-lamix

## Alert: StatRelay Sidecar Flush Lag

This alert fires when the StatRelay metrics-aggregation sidecar falls more than 120 seconds behind on flushing buffered samples to the Coalmine backend. Plugin-emitted counters are buffered in-process, so sustained lag usually means a plugin is emitting unbounded label cardinality or blocking the flush thread. Check your plugin's metric registration against the published cardinality limits before escalating. If the lag persists after your plugin is ruled out, contact the telemetry team.

escalation mailbox, bagug-fahof: novdor.wendor.jormir@norvalabs.example

Ticket: Ledgervine ORM refactor blocked — config vault locked

Support team, heads up: the vault holding the legacy Ledgervine ORM connection secrets locked itself mid-refactor, so the mapping migration is paused. Customers may see stale records until tomorrow. If anyone needs to unseal it for an urgent fix, the recovery passphrase is right below.

strongbox words: zoreth-fraox-oliius-aldeth-jorax-praeth-holmir-drumir-prawyn